After making it a bit higher to get rid of the fret buzz, handling this guitar and accessing all corners of the fretboard was really easy and smooth. I had to admit that the crunch tones were the ones I least enjoyed with this Donner, but it doesn’t mean this axe sounds bad with crunch, it just was just not my favorite use for this guitar. The tremolo works as expected: using it smoothly, loses the tuning a little, affecting more the G string, and loses the tuning a lot in extreme use (you can lock it to avoid this). To be fair, let’s look at it for what it is: more in the class of a Squire Strat, a Rogue, or similar starter guitar.
